August 10, 1999 
12:00 Noon 
Dear Member: 
I am writing to update you on the MCI WorldCom outage that has resulted in a suspension of trading on Project AŽ since last Thursday night. 
Based on assurances from MCI WorldCom and internal testing by the Chicago Board of Trade, trading on Project A will resume today at 2:15 p.m. Chicago time. Normal Project A trading hours will then be in effect. 
We have developed a contingency plan to resume Project A trading tomorrow in the event that MCI WorldCom were to again experience a major outage that disrupts service. This plan involves placing additional Project A workstations within the CBOT building for members and member firms, in order to take advantage of our local area network, which is fully operational. 
I will continue to keep you informed of developments. 
Sincerely, 
Thomas R Donovan
